Subject: Key rotation — config hot-reload service

For the weekly eng sync: the credential used by the Tarnwell hot-reload agent rotates this Thursday. The agent watches the central config bus and applies changes without restarts, so a failed auth means stale configs, not outages — but please verify your services pick up at least one change post-rotation. Rollback instructions are in the Tarnwell runbook, section four. Old keys are revoked Friday noon. The replacement key for the internal config bus is included below for deployment.

service key, fawip-bajef: kto11_Qt5wZK9vdNC

Status: active. Objective: qualify a backup supplier for the Nexoril valve assemblies currently single-sourced from Quarrow Fabrication. Three candidates shortlisted: two in the Ashdale corridor, one in Port Melling. Sample parts due in four weeks; qualification testing adds six more. Cost delta estimated at 6–9% over incumbent pricing, acceptable given continuity risk. Incoming director to own final vendor selection and contract terms. Do not discuss outside this group until qualification completes. Strategic background is captured below.

confidential, kagup-bafog: Fraaxax Group is in early talks to buy Soroxox Group for about $343.8 million. The Olidor launch date is June 14, and nothing goes to the press before then. Legal wants the Aldmirek Logistics term sheet signed before July 23.

Hi all — a note for whoever maintains this next. The Signalbridge alert deduplicator now collapses alerts sharing a fingerprint within a five-minute window. Partner integrations should see fewer duplicate pages but identical payload shapes. Config lives in dedup.toml; window size is adjustable per source. To exercise the staging dedup endpoint during verification, authenticate with the token below.

session JWT of yawep-yawep = eyJhbGciOiJIUzI1NiIsInR5cCI6IkpXVCJ9.eyJzdWIiOiI3pWF3_In0.aXYsHiog

## Runbook: ParcelPing webhook account recovery

If the Trundle dispatcher account locks after three failed webhook signature rotations, stop retries immediately. Disable the ParcelPing consumer, clear the stale token cache, and re-register the endpoint in the staging console first. Do not rotate keys twice in one window. Once the endpoint is verified, unlock the account using the passphrase below.

unlock words, hahip-baduf: holwyn-istath-julvan